Google Ads MCP

Read-only MCP server for the Google Ads API. Eleven tools cover discovery, GAQL reporting, resource schema, recommendations, keyword planning and forecasts, and change history for any account reachable under a manager account (MCC). We run this server in production for every ads client. Read-only is enforced at three layers: no mutate or apply service imports, an SDK method allowlist, and a GAQL-starts-with-SELECT guard.

Setup

This is the heaviest setup in the gallery: expect up to two days waiting on developer token approval. One set of credentials, rooted at a manager account (MCC), can read any customer account linked under it, so there is no per-client configuration beyond linking an account to the MCC.

  1. Google Ads developer token. Sign in at ads.google.com under your manager account, go to Tools and Settings, API Center, and apply for a developer token. A new token starts on the Explorer access level, which Google grants after a review that can take a few days; discovery, query and recommendation tools work there. Basic access (a separate application) is needed for higher quotas and may be needed for the keyword-planning tools.
  2. Google Cloud OAuth client. In a Google Cloud project, enable the Google Ads API, then create an OAuth client ID of type Desktop app under APIs and Services, Credentials. Note the client ID and client secret, and add the https://www.googleapis.com/auth/adwords scope to the OAuth consent screen.
  3. Refresh token. Generate a refresh token once, as an admin user of the manager account, using Google's oauth2l tool or the generate_user_credentials.py example shipped with the google-ads Python library. Save the refresh token; it does not expire from normal use.
  4. Login customer ID. Use the 10-digit customer ID of the manager account itself (no hyphens) as GOOGLE_ADS_LOGIN_CUSTOMER_ID. Any client account accepts an invite to link under this manager account in its own Google Ads UI, after which google_ads_list_customer_clients sees it.

Tools (11)

Tool What it does
google_ads_list_accessible_customers List every customer_id the OAuth user has direct access to
google_ads_list_customer_clients Walk the MCC hierarchy and return every child account
google_ads_query Run a GAQL query against a specific customer account
google_ads_describe_resource Schema (fields, metrics, segments) for a GAQL resource
google_ads_list_resources Return the full catalog of GAQL resources
google_ads_recommendations Read Google's optimization recommendations for a customer account
google_ads_keyword_ideas Generate keyword ideas with search volume, competition and CPC estimates
google_ads_keyword_historical_metrics Historical monthly search-volume and competition metrics for specific keywords
google_ads_keyword_forecast_metrics Forecast KPIs for a proposed keyword plan
google_ads_change_events Audit trail of who changed what, last 30 days
google_ads_change_status Lightweight last-modified change tracker per resource

Reply shape

Every tool returns JSON with status (succeeded, partial, no_op), operation, summary, target, result, proof, warnings, recovery. Failures surface as a tool error whose text is google_ads_request_failed: <message> <hint>. proof.apiVersion names the Google Ads API version used. proof.microsConverted is set on google_ads_query. A partial status means the result hit its configured bound (max_rows, page_size or limit); recovery.nextAction says how to continue.

Limits

google_ads_query responses are capped at 64 MB per call by the Google Ads API; split large date ranges across calls. KeywordPlanIdeaService (keyword ideas, historical metrics, forecasts) is rate-limited to 1 query per second and may require Basic Access if you get a permission error on the Explorer tier. google_ads_change_events covers up to 30 days back; google_ads_change_status covers up to 14 days back. metrics.cost_micros and other *_micros fields are 1 unit = $0.000001; google_ads_query emits a matching *_units field alongside when convert_micros is true (the default).
